In-Text Antisthenes, initiated into the mysteries of Orpheus, hearing that all of that Religion were happy, said, Why do they not then die? Who is loth to go home where most known and knowing? The Sea man gladly goes off the raging Sea ad fortunatas insulas. The Soldier after many bloody battels is glad of his quietus est, of his quiet and well-provisioned winter-quarters.
